HamburgerMenu
hirist

Emulation Engineer/Lead

PRETORIUS STAFFING SOLUTIONS
4 - 15 Years
Multiple Locations

Posted on: 23/04/2026

Job Description

Role : Emulation Engineer/Lead - 4 to 12 Years

Job Description :


- Candidate must have experience in Pre-Silicon Validation, Emulation/FPGA based platforms

- Experience in developing C/C++/SystemC tests in HDL-HVL Co-emulation platforms

- Experience in IO bus protocols such as I2C, SPI, USB, and/or PCIe

- Experience in debugging tools for systems-on-chip (SoCs) - eg. JTAG, Trace32

"Nice To Have" Skills and Experience :

- Knowledge of ASIC design flow, ASIC prototyping flow, and similar

- Knowledge of SystemC/C/C++ and UVM/SV verification languages

- Experience in these domains: PCIe, Flash, Memory, CPU, GPU, DRAM

- Experience with Emulation Tool Chains: Zebu, Veloce, Palladium.

Roles & Responsibilities:

- Develop and execute validation plans for pre-silicon environments using emulation and FPGA-based platforms.

- Design, develop, and maintain test cases in C/C++/SystemC for HDL-HVL co-emulation frameworks.

- Validate and verify SoC functionality by creating robust test scenarios across different subsystems.

- Work on debugging and root cause analysis using industry-standard tools such as JTAG and Trace32.

- Develop and validate test suites for various IO bus protocols including I2C, SPI, USB, and PCIe.

- Collaborate with design, verification, and firmware teams to ensure functional correctness and performance of SoC designs.

- Analyze test results, identify issues, and provide detailed debug reports with actionable insights.

- Contribute to the bring-up and validation of ASIC prototypes and emulation platforms.

- Support integration and validation of key subsystems such as CPU, GPU, Memory, DRAM, Flash, and PCIe interfaces.

- Work with emulation tool chains like Zebu, Veloce, and Palladium for large-scale SoC validation.

- Participate in improving validation methodologies, automation frameworks, and regression environments.

- Ensure compliance with verification plans and contribute to coverage closure activities.

- Stay aligned with ASIC design and prototyping flows to enhance validation efficiency and quality.

info-icon

Did you find something suspicious?

Similar jobs that you might be interested in